Re: z3ta+ for $20
They had a good run with this synth selling it at $249 for 2-3 years before they ran out of ideas for the annual Sonar upgrades and chucked it in free with SOnar 7PE.
Decent wavetable based synth though, $20 is good value for non Sonar, PC users.

Re: z3ta+ for $20
This synth arrived with my Sonar , but i haven't began using it till it appeared in Live for me. Pretty gutsy synth and very easily tweaked. Has been used in many trance tracks over the years. Personally i preffer sylenth1. But if you're on PC, for $20 this is great value imo.
